REQUEST FOR ADDITIONAL INFORMATION CALVERT CLIFFS NUCLEAR POWER PLANT, UNIT NOS. 1 AND 2 The proposed changes to the Technical Specifications (TS) create an opportunity for a different release pathway than was previously assumed for a design basis fuel-handling accident (FHA) in the spent fuel pool area. This may increase the radiological consequences in the control room of the design basis FHA over that previously calculated, due to a difference in the atmospheric dispersion factor assumed for a release from that pathway.

a.

With respect to control room habitability, does the intent of 10 CFR Part 50, Appendix A, General Design Criterion 19 continue to be met for the proposed changes to the TSs and the resulting change in the operation of the spent fuel pool exhaust ventilation system after an FHA in the spent fuel pool area, including reconstitution/inspection activities? How is this determined?

b.

If an analysis of the control room habitability for the FHA in the spent fuel pool area has been performed in support of the license amendment request, provide the analysis assumptions, inputs, and results.
